About
Mr. Delano is one of America's top branding strategists and the creative genius behind such superstar names as Oldsmobile's Intrigue sports sedan, Nissan's Pathfinder sport utility vehicle, Pfizer's Zoloft antidepressant, GMC's Yukon utility truck, and Primerica financial services. In The Omnipowerful Brand, he reveals a wealth of specific tips, insider secrets, and lessons from behind the scenes - more ready-to-work information than any other naming or branding book ever produced. Step by field-tested step, Mr. Delano guides you through the seven proven principles and his own breakthrough process for branding companies, products, services, or business ventures. You'll find practical guidelines for channeling your creativity in productive directions. You'll learn to capture the essence of a product and then name that essence in a powerful, compelling way. You'll be privy to the author's insight on how to avoid the "Misery Name" - and you'll discover crucial information on how to measure the appropriateness of the names you've developed and evaluate them for use and availability.
